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Frozen French Toast Sticks
Choosing the best frozen french toast sticks involves more than just flavor. Several factors can significantly impact your experience, from ingredient quality to preparation convenience. Understanding these factors helps you avoid common pitfalls, like sacrificing health for taste or paying too much for features you don’t need. Here are key considerations that should guide your decision:Flavor and Texture
Flavor and texture are the main reasons people enjoy french toast sticks, so look for options with a good balance of sweetness and a crispy exterior with a soft interior. Some products offer added cinnamon or glaze for extra flavor, while others stick to a more traditional taste. Keep in mind that texture can vary based on preparation method—oven baking usually yields a crispier result than microwave heating. Reading reviews and ingredient lists can help you gauge how close these sticks come to homemade quality.
Ingredient Quality
Many frozen options include preservatives, artificial flavors, or added sugars, which can influence healthiness and taste. If ingredient quality is a priority, look for products labeled as whole grain or with minimal artificial additives. Higher-quality ingredients often mean a better flavor experience and a more wholesome snack, though they may come at a higher price. Balancing cost and ingredient standards is key to making a satisfying choice.
Convenience and Packaging
Consider how you plan to serve the french toast sticks. Individually wrapped options offer quick, mess-free servings ideal for busy mornings or packed lunches. Bulk packages are usually more economical but require portioning and preparation time. Also, think about storage space—larger bags save money but take up more room in your freezer. The decision hinges on your schedule and how you prefer to serve these breakfast treats.
Price and Value
While some brands come at a premium, they often justify the higher cost with better ingredients or a superior texture. Conversely, budget options can be more than adequate for occasional use but may lack consistency in taste or quality. Calculate the price per serving to get a realistic sense of value, especially if you plan to buy in bulk. Sometimes, paying a little more upfront results in a noticeably better product and a more satisfying breakfast experience.
Versatility and Dietary Needs
Some frozen french toast sticks are more versatile than others—they can be toasted, baked, or microwaved for different textures. If you have specific dietary needs, such as gluten-free or whole grain, verify the product labels carefully. Consider whether the product is suitable for children or adults, as some options are geared more toward families with kids. Matching the product’s features to your specific needs will lead to greater satisfaction.

How should I prepare frozen french toast sticks for best taste?
For optimal flavor and texture, baking or toasting is recommended over microwave heating, as these methods yield a crispy exterior. Preheat your oven to around 375°F and bake for 10-15 minutes, flipping halfway through. Using a toaster oven can also help achieve a similar result. Microwaving is quicker but often results in a softer, less crispy stick. Adjust the heating time based on your appliance and preference for crispness.

Can frozen french toast sticks be gluten-free?
Yes, gluten-free options are available but are less common. These products use alternative flours like rice or almond flour to cater to dietary restrictions. Always check the packaging carefully to confirm gluten-free certification, as cross-contamination can occur. For those with gluten sensitivities or celiac disease, choosing dedicated gluten-free brands ensures safety and peace of mind.
